Blind Cleaning questions, answered by experts

A microfiber cloth or blind duster is typically the best tool for normal dust accumulation, depending on the extent of the dirt. However, if the blinds are unusually dirty or require scrubbing, or if they’re made of a more delicate material such as wood, check with the blind manufacturer for cleaning recommendations. Cleaning professionals will have the tools and experience necessary to tackle your blinds, making them look new again.

Professionals either use microfiber cloths and a gentle cleaning solution or a vacuum for basic blind cleaning. Deeper blind cleaning may use a dry cleaning or ultrasonic process typically performed on-site at their business with special equipment.

DIY cleaning is possible but may not remove deep dust, stains, or allergens as effectively as professional methods.

Although it’s essential to clean your blinds every month or two as a best practice for keeping them dirt and dust-free, professional blind cleaning is often a more practical way to go. One significant benefit to having your blinds cleaned professionally is the overall saved time, as cleaning them yourself can be time-consuming. Other benefits include:

  • Ensuring that dirt and dust, which can cause health issues in those with sensitivities, are fully removed

  • Increasing the life expectancy of your current blinds to save money on replacements

  • Ensuring that your blinds are cleaned thoroughly and correctly, as blinds can be complex
